ITI Beirut Study Club Explores the Latest Advances in Peri-Implant Bone Loss and Peri-Implantitis

On June 25, 2026, Prodent proudly hosted the ITI Middle East Section – Beirut Study Club, bringing together implant dentistry professionals for an engaging evening of scientific learning and clinical discussion. The event featured two distinguished Lebanese experts, Prof. Georges Tawil and Dr. Joseph Ryan Younes, who shared evidence-based insights into one of the most relevant topics in modern implant dentistry: peri-implant bone loss and peri-implantitis.

Prof. Georges Tawil opened the session with a comprehensive lecture titled “Peri-implant Bone Loss: From Diagnosis to Treatment. Where Do We Stand Today?”, reviewing the latest concepts in diagnosis, treatment planning, and current clinical evidence surrounding peri-implant bone loss. His presentation provided attendees with valuable perspectives on today’s therapeutic approaches and long-term implant success.

Building on these foundations, Dr. Joseph Ryan Younes presented “Recognize, Diagnose, Treat: A Clinician’s Guide to Peri-Implantitis,” offering practical protocols for the early detection, accurate diagnosis, and effective management of peri-implant disease. The session emphasized the importance of timely intervention and evidence-based decision-making in everyday clinical practice.

Moderated by Dr. Carole Chakar and Dr. Bassam Borgi, Directors of the ITI Beirut Study Club, the evening concluded with an interactive discussion that encouraged participants to exchange clinical experiences, ask questions, and explore real-world treatment strategies.
